In reality, most of us buy a TV by what we can afford, not necessarily by features. CNET.com has a really nice TV buying guidelinks that breaks down these price ranges:
  • Less than $300
  • $300 to $500
  • $500 to $750
  • $750 to $1,000
  • $1,000 to $1,500
  • $1,500 to $3,000
  • More than $3,000
See the TV Buying Guide at CNET.com
